The SIXAXIS controller, originally bundled with the PS3, has been upgraded into the DualShock 3. This combines the features of the motion-sensitive SIXAXIS controller with the force feedback functions of the PS2’s DualShock 2 controller. The controller operates wirelessly via Bluetooth techonology, though they can also be wired with a USB-to-USB mini cable which is also used to charge the device.
